当前位置: 首页 > news >正文

还在为多屏需求烦恼?虚拟显示器工具让你的电脑瞬间扩展

还在为多屏需求烦恼?虚拟显示器工具让你的电脑瞬间扩展

【免费下载链接】virtual-display-rsA Windows virtual display driver to add multiple virtual monitors to your PC! For Win10+. Works with VR, obs, streaming software, etc项目地址: https://gitcode.com/gh_mirrors/vi/virtual-display-rs

在数字化工作与娱乐日益融合的今天,我们常常面临屏幕空间不足的困境——程序员需要同时查看代码与文档,设计师需要对比素材与效果,远程办公者则希望在视频会议时保持其他窗口可见。虚拟显示器工具正是解决这些痛点的创新方案,它能让你的Windows 10及以上系统无需额外硬件即可添加多个虚拟显示器,轻松实现多屏工作流。

虚拟显示器的核心价值:重新定义屏幕空间

虚拟显示器本质上是一种软件驱动技术,它通过模拟物理显示器的信号输出,让操作系统识别并管理额外的显示设备。与传统物理显示器相比,它具有三大核心优势:

  • 零硬件成本:无需购买昂贵的显示器和连接线,只需软件配置即可扩展显示空间
  • 灵活配置:支持从1080p到4K的多种分辨率设置,可随时添加或移除虚拟显示器
  • 跨场景适配:完美支持VR体验、远程桌面、直播推流等专业场景需求

💻技术原理小贴士:虚拟显示器通过创建虚拟显示适配器(类似显卡的软件模拟),向Windows系统注册新的显示设备,从而实现多屏扩展。这就像在电脑内部开辟了"数字分身",让系统误以为连接了多个物理显示器。

解决多屏需求:三步完成虚拟显示器基础配置

准备条件

  • Windows 10或以上操作系统
  • 管理员权限(驱动安装必需)
  • 网络连接(用于获取项目源码)

执行操作

📂步骤1:获取项目源码打开终端,执行以下命令克隆项目仓库:

git clone https://gitcode.com/gh_mirrors/vi/virtual-display-rs

🔧步骤2:安装驱动证书

  1. 导航至项目目录下的installer文件夹
  2. 找到install-cert.bat文件,右键选择"以管理员身份运行"
  3. 按照命令行提示完成证书安装

⚠️ 注意:证书安装是确保系统信任驱动的关键步骤,未安装证书会导致驱动无法正常加载

🖥️步骤3:安装虚拟显示器驱动

  1. 进入installer/files目录,双击运行install.reg文件
  2. 打开设备管理器(Win+X → 设备管理器)
  3. 点击"操作"菜单 → "添加过时硬件"
  4. 选择"安装我手动从列表选择的硬件" → "显示适配器"
  5. 点击"从磁盘安装",浏览至rust/virtual-display-driver/VirtualDisplayDriver.inf文件
  6. 完成驱动安装并重启电脑

验证结果

重启后,打开"显示设置"(Win+I → 系统 → 显示),若看到多个显示器图标即表示配置成功。默认情况下会添加一个1920×1080分辨率的虚拟显示器。

虚拟显示器场景化解决方案:从办公到娱乐的全场景覆盖

远程办公场景:打造高效虚拟工作台

远程工作时,虚拟显示器可以将单一物理屏幕划分为多个独立工作区:

  • 主屏幕:视频会议窗口
  • 虚拟屏幕1:文档编辑区
  • 虚拟屏幕2:项目管理工具
  • 虚拟屏幕3:即时通讯软件

![虚拟显示器远程办公场景示意图](https://raw.gitcode.com/gh_mirrors/vi/virtual-display-rs/raw/13bafda435260d232a7190e621f8d97f24c2f5c5/Virtual Display Driver Control/Assets/LargeTile.scale-400.png?utm_source=gitcode_repo_files)虚拟显示器让远程办公时的多任务处理变得轻松高效

内容创作场景:扩展创意空间

对于设计师和视频创作者,虚拟显示器提供了灵活的工作环境:

  • 主屏幕:编辑软件工作区
  • 虚拟屏幕:素材库与参考资料
  • 辅助屏幕:调色板与效果预览

游戏娱乐场景:多视角游戏体验

游戏玩家可以利用虚拟显示器实现:

  • 主屏幕:游戏主视角
  • 虚拟屏幕1:游戏地图与数据统计
  • 虚拟屏幕2:直播控制台或聊天窗口

虚拟显示器进阶技巧:释放更多可能性

自定义分辨率与刷新率

通过"Virtual Display Driver Control"应用,你可以为每个虚拟显示器设置特定参数:

  1. 打开开始菜单中的"Virtual Display Driver Control"
  2. 点击"添加显示器"按钮
  3. 在分辨率下拉菜单中选择预设值或自定义分辨率
  4. 调整刷新率(建议设置为60Hz或与主显示器一致)
  5. 点击"应用"保存设置

命令行高级控制

高级用户可以通过命令行工具精确控制虚拟显示器:

# 进入工具目录 cd rust/virtual-display-driver-cli # 添加一个2560×1440分辨率的虚拟显示器 cargo run -- add --width 2560 --height 1440 # 列出所有虚拟显示器 cargo run -- list # 移除指定ID的虚拟显示器 cargo run -- remove --id 2

多显示器排列优化

合理的显示器排列能显著提升工作效率:

  • 扩展模式:适合需要连续工作区的场景(如视频剪辑)
  • 复制模式:适合演示或监控场景
  • 垂直排列:适合代码编辑等长文档场景

常见问题解决方案

问题现象排查方向解决方法
驱动安装失败证书问题重新运行install-cert.bat并确保管理员权限
虚拟显示器不显示设备冲突在设备管理器中卸载并重新扫描硬件
分辨率设置无效驱动版本更新项目源码并重新编译驱动
系统卡顿资源占用降低虚拟显示器分辨率或减少数量

虚拟显示器社区支持与贡献指南

获取帮助

如果你在使用过程中遇到问题,可以通过以下渠道获取支持:

  • 项目Issue跟踪:提交详细的问题描述和系统环境信息
  • 讨论区:与其他用户交流使用经验和解决方案
  • 文档中心:查阅详细的配置指南和高级功能说明

贡献代码

虚拟显示器项目欢迎社区贡献:

  1. Fork项目仓库并创建分支
  2. 提交代码前确保通过所有测试
  3. 提交Pull Request时详细描述功能变更
  4. 参与代码审查并根据反馈改进

问题反馈

发现bug或有功能建议?请提供:

  • 系统版本和硬件配置
  • 问题复现步骤
  • 错误日志(位于C:\ProgramData\VirtualDisplayDriver\logs
  • 截图或录屏(如适用)

总结

虚拟显示器工具彻底改变了我们使用电脑的方式,它以软件定义的灵活性打破了物理硬件的限制,让每台电脑都能轻松扩展为多屏工作站。无论你是需要高效办公的专业人士,还是追求沉浸式体验的娱乐用户,虚拟显示器都能为你打开新的可能性。

现在就开始探索虚拟显示器的世界,释放你的屏幕空间潜能吧!随着项目的不断发展,未来还将支持更多高级功能,敬请期待。

【免费下载链接】virtual-display-rsA Windows virtual display driver to add multiple virtual monitors to your PC! For Win10+. Works with VR, obs, streaming software, etc项目地址: https://gitcode.com/gh_mirrors/vi/virtual-display-rs

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

http://www.jsqmd.com/news/535562/

相关文章:

  • Windows资源管理器无法挂载VHDX?修复指南
  • 前后端分离的RuoYi如何优雅集成OnlyOffice?一份保姆级配置与代码详解
  • 蚂蚁入股 AI 玩具跃然创新,后者首家线下门店将开业;MiniMax Coding Plan 升级为 Token Plan,支持全模态模型调用丨日报
  • 从闲鱼方案到稳定驱动:一个大学生用DRV8701驱动电机的踩坑与填坑全记录
  • 已经用微服务了还用引入模块化开发?
  • 2026 SAE法兰十大品牌推荐:SAE焊接法兰SAE扩口式法兰生产SAE扩口/保持环法兰的厂家无焊接SAE法兰有船级社形式认可证书的SAE法兰厂家权威榜单 - 呼呼拉呼
  • 旧设备焕新:用OpenCore Legacy Patcher开源工具重获新生
  • 在LubanCat RK3568上跑通YOLOv5:手把手教你用RKNN-Toolkit-lite2部署目标检测模型
  • nli-distilroberta-base在智能写作中的实战:大纲与正文段落逻辑连贯性自动评估
  • 国标视频平台API治理:从混乱到有序的自动化方案
  • MelonLoader:Unity游戏模组加载框架全解析
  • 新手入门网络安全:从 0 基础到实战上岗,保姆级避坑 + 工具全汇总
  • PyTorch 2.8镜像部署案例:政务AI问答系统私有化部署的硬件适配方案
  • jfinal_cms-v5.1.0 代码审计
  • [Redis小技巧27]Redis Cluster 全景指南:Gossip 协议、故障转移与生产避坑实战
  • 创新部署策略:如何高效配置OpenCore黑苹果安装环境
  • 2026 年工业防腐涂料专业品牌选择 行业经验参考
  • OrCAD Library Builder 17.2安装避坑指南:从破解失败到成功导出的完整流程
  • Jimeng AI Studio效果展示:Z-Image Turbo在人物肖像生成中的皮肤质感表现
  • BlendLuxCore:重新定义3D渲染的光影魔术师
  • 洛谷 P1192:台阶问题 ← 动态规划 + 前缀和优化
  • 告别官方工具:手把手教你用Python+OpenNI2驱动Astra Pro,打造自定义深度应用
  • Ubuntu 20.04 下 Vitis 2021.2 离线安装全记录:从77G压缩包到环境变量配置(附磁盘分区建议)
  • 轻量级JS工具库Verge:提升前端开发效率的实战指南
  • 3个认知转变:从文档奴隶到可视化架构师
  • JavaScript——JSON序列化和反序列化
  • mFS:面向EEPROM的轻量级嵌入式文件系统
  • 必收藏!京东大模型算法工程师面经+薪资全解析 985硕纠结要不要去?
  • 如何在ESXi 6.7上完美驱动Realtek RTL8125网卡:完整编译与部署指南
  • 有关zstuacm集训队的部分内容提醒